Common Causes Of Ecobee Not Responding
Several issues can cause an Ecobee to stop responding, including power supply problems, network connectivity failures, outdated firmware, faulty wiring, and app/account glitches. Understanding the root cause helps prioritize the most effective solution and prevents unnecessary troubleshooting steps.
- Power supply problems: Insufficient power, tripped breakers, or a malfunctioning Power Extender Kit (PEK) can prevent the thermostat from waking up.
- Network connectivity: Wi‑Fi drops, router issues, or weak signal can stop the Ecobee from communicating with cloud services.
- Firmware or software issues: Outdated firmware or corrupted settings may render the display unresponsive or delay responses to input.
- Wiring or sensor issues: Loose wires, damaged C-wire, or faulty internal sensors can impact operation or power delivery.
- Account or app problems: Problems signing in, permissions, or app synchronization can make the thermostat seem non-responsive.
Quick Fixes To Try First
Begin with simple, non-invasive steps that resolve many common problems. These actions are safe for most homeowners and do not require tools.
- Restart the Ecobee: Hold the main dial for 10–15 seconds until the screen restarts, or use the menu to perform a soft reboot.
- Check the power: Verify the circuit breaker is ON for the Ecobee’s circuit and ensure the indoor power supply is steady. If a PEK is installed, ensure it is properly connected.
- Verify Wi‑Fi: Confirm the thermostat is within range of the router, and that the network is active. Reboot the router if necessary.
- Update firmware: If the thermostat is responsive enough to navigate, check for firmware updates and install any available ones.
- Re-sign into the app: Sign out of the Ecobee app and sign back in to refresh account associations and device status.
Electrical And Power Considerations
Power issues are among the most common causes of non-responsiveness. Correct power delivery is essential for reliable operation.
- Power Extender Kit (PEK) checks: The PEK should be wired per Ecobee’s instructions. Miswiring can cause the thermostat to fail to power on.
- C‑wire status: A missing or weak common wire can lead to insufficient power. If a C-wire is not present, consider a professional assessment or alternate power solutions.
- Thermostat location: Extreme temperatures, drafts, or proximity to heat sources can affect power draw and sensor accuracy.
Connectivity And Network Troubleshooting
Stable network access is crucial for remote control and automatic updates. Addressing network issues can restore responsiveness both locally and in the cloud.
- Router compatibility: Ensure the router supports 802.11n or newer and that the Ecobee is authorized on the network.
- Signal strength: Place the Ecobee within a strong Wi‑Fi signal zone; consider a Wi‑Fi extender if the device is far from the router.
- IP address conflicts: Reserve a static IP for the Ecobee in the router settings to prevent changes that could disrupt connectivity.
- Firewall and security: Ensure the network allows Ecobee traffic to Ecobee servers if customized firewall rules exist.
App And Account Related Issues
Sometimes the thermostat itself is fine; account or app problems can make it seem unresponsive. Addressing login or sync issues often restores control.

- Sign-in and permissions: Verify the account is active and that the correct user has access to the home. Re-invite other users if needed.
- App version: Use the latest Ecobee app version on iOS or Android to avoid compatibility bugs.
- Device removal and re-adding: In cases of persistent sync issues, remove the Ecobee from the app and re-add it carefully following the prompts.
Firmware, Settings, And Safety
Outdated firmware or corrupted settings can impair performance. Systematic updates and careful setting verification help maintain reliability.
- Factory reset as a last resort: If problems persist after updates and routine troubleshooting, a factory reset may be considered, but back up schedules and settings first.
- Schedule and automation sanity check: Conflicting schedules or automation routines can lead to unexpected behavior; review active programs for conflicts.
- Compatibility with HVAC equipment: Confirm that thermostat compatibility with current heating and cooling equipment remains intact after updates or after changing equipment.
Hardware Checks And Maintenance
Physical hardware issues can render the Ecobee unresponsive. Visual inspection and careful testing can identify issues without professional intervention.
- Display and touch responsiveness: If the screen is unresponsive, a reboot or refresh may help; persistent unresponsiveness could indicate a hardware fault.
- Wiring inspection: With power off, check that wires are securely connected to the HVAC control board and to the Ecobee base. Look for loose terminals or damaged insulation.
- Sensor accuracy: Ensure temperature sensors are not obstructed or placed in direct heat sources, which can cause incorrect readings and erratic behavior.
When To Seek Professional Help
If none of the above steps restore responsiveness, consider professional support. A licensed HVAC technician or Ecobee support specialist can diagnose wiring, power supply, or deeper firmware problems and confirm compatibility with current HVAC equipment.
Before calling, collect details such as model number, current firmware version, recent changes to wiring or network, and a summary of troubleshooting steps already performed. This information speeds up diagnostics and reduces service time.
